    Service was outstanding. Angel was on top of everything. The staff was always pleasant and easy to work with. We stayed for two nights in the Fly Fisherman's cottage. It was clean, roomy and very nicely designed. The bedding (sheets, pillows and mattress was wonderful. There was a minor issue with the plug for the bathtub not closing. It was remedied right away. The location on Tomales Bay was gorgeous.

    The food in the restaurant was not as good as advertised. We were told that the highly rated chef left a few months ago. The meals that we had we good, but not outstanding.

    Lovely Northern California spot on Tomales Bay. The room was lovely, with wood burning stove, leather sofa, comfy king size bed, and the best bathroom ever! Bathroom had heated tile floors, his and hers sinks, clawfoot tub, and a beautiful walk in shower. We stayed in "Fly Fisherman" cottage.
